Training pubs for teenagers

February 26, 2008

A pub could be opened in West Lancashire for under 18s as part of plans to tackle underage drinking in the district.
After months of research, surveys, consultation with teenagers and an alcohol conference, an action plan has been put together which aims to educate youngsters to drink sensibly in a traditional pub setting.

Saracen’s Head lives again – updated

February 12, 2008

The Saracen’s Head in Halsall will reopen soon.
As previously reported, the canal-side pub near Ormskirk has been closed for some time but a spokesman for Punch Taverns, which owns the building, said: “The existing licensees are signing over the pub to new licensees.”

Saracen’s Head closed

February 7, 2008

The Saracen’s Head pub on the banks of the Leeds/Liverpool Canal at Halsall, Ormskirk, has been closed down for a month now, windows boarded up and not a soul to be seen.

Crawford Arms

January 11, 2008

Popular West Lancashire pub the Crawford Arms has been put on the market for £100,000 with the Leeds office of business sales agents Davey & Co. The Crawford village pub has an annual turnover approaching £400,000, so there are hopes that a new leaseholder will step in soon.

The Queen is dead

December 16, 2007

I was sorry to see that the Queen Inn, of Aughton Street, Ormskirk, closed as I drove past today on my way to a party. A fellow guest told me it has been boarded up for about a month now and there’s not much hope that someone will take it on.

New look for Windmill

October 9, 2007

The Windmill Inn, Ormskirk, has been given a modern makeover by a group of four friends. The two married couples took over the pub on Wigan Road after the last manager was ill.
